MSCs修饰受体胸腺对异种心脏移植免疫排斥反应的作用研究

摘    要:目的大鼠胸腺以豚鼠骨髓间充质干细胞进行修饰,然后行豚鼠到大鼠的异种心脏移植。研究以间充质干细胞修饰胸腺对异种移植心脏存活时间的影响。方法供体豚鼠和受体SD大鼠各20只随机分成四组,A组(对照组);B组(胸腺修饰IT组);C组(CVF组);D组(IT加CVF组)。观测指标:移植心脏存活时间,病理变化,供受体异种淋巴细胞毒性试验。结果供心平均存活时间:A组(23.20±6.14)min,B组(24.20±9.28)min,C组(335.40±49.23)min,D组(451.00±50.10)min。A与B组两组比较,差异无统计学意义(P>0.05)。C、D组平均存活时间较A、B明显延长,差异有统计学意义(P<0.05)。D组与C组组间比较差异有统计学意义(P<0.05)。供受体淋巴细胞反应,测得光密度值分别为:D组为(381.20±12.01),A组为(590.20±15.38),胸腺修饰组明显低于对照组,差异有统计学意义(P<0.05)。结论豚鼠到大鼠心脏异种移植中,豚鼠MSCs修饰大鼠胸腺,当克服HAR后可以延长供心存活时间,但并不能完全克服AVR的发生。

Effect of intrathymic inoculation to cardiac xenograft rejection with mesenchymal stem cells

Abstract:Objective To investigate the effect of intrathymic inoculation with guinea pig's MSCs on the discordant rodent cardiac xenograft in the model of guinea pig to rat xenotransplantation. Methods Donor (twenty guniea pigs) and recipient (twenty SD rats) were randomly divided into four groups, including group A (control group), group B (IT group), group C (CVF group), group D (CVF plus IT inoculation with MSCs group).The guinea pig's grafted heart mean survival time, the optical density of mixed cell reaction and the pathology were observed. Results MST of group A was (23.20±6.14)min, group B was (24.20±9.28)min, group C was (335.40±49.23)min, and group D was (451.00±50.10)min. The difference between group A and group B was not statistically significant (P > 0.05).Group C and group D were significantly longer than that of group A and group B(P < 0.05). The difference of MST was statistically significant in group D and group C (P < 0.05).The results of MCR of group IT was (381.20±12.01). Control group was (590.20±15.38). The optical density of group IT was much lower than control group (P < 0.05). Conclusion Intrathymic inoculation with MSCs of guinea pig can prolong the survival time of xenoheart by using Chinese cobra venom factor.
